What is a Data Masker?
A data masker is a privacy protection tool that replaces sensitive information with asterisks or other characters to prevent unauthorized access while maintaining the original data structure. Our simple data masker automatically detects and masks various types of sensitive data including credit card numbers, phone numbers, email addresses, Social Security numbers, and other personally identifiable information (PII).
Data masking is essential for compliance with privacy regulations like GDPR, HIPAA, and CCPA, allowing organizations to use realistic data for testing, training, and demonstration purposes without exposing actual sensitive information. Common Uses for Data Masking
GDPR & Privacy Compliance
Organizations must protect personal data according to privacy regulations. Data masking helps achieve compliance by replacing sensitive information with masked equivalents, allowing legitimate business operations while protecting individual privacy. This is essential for handling customer data, employee records, and financial information.
Software Testing & Development
Development teams need realistic data for testing applications without exposing actual customer information. Masked data maintains the structure and patterns of real data while protecting privacy, enabling thorough testing of applications, databases, and business logic without security risks.
Documentation & Training
When creating user manuals, training materials, or presentation slides, real sensitive data must be protected. Data masking allows you to use realistic examples in documentation while ensuring no actual personal information is disclosed, maintaining professionalism and legal compliance.
Log Analysis & Troubleshooting
System logs often contain sensitive user information that must be protected during analysis and troubleshooting. Masked logs allow technical teams to diagnose issues and analyze patterns while maintaining user privacy and meeting security requirements for data handling and storage.
